• We back entrepreneurs and management teams of mid-market companies with an EV typically between €100m – €500m

• We back international growth plans, providing access to our network and expertise to accelerate growth

• We look for situations where there are structural opportunities to enhance and drive value growth, e.g. expanding sales into new regions, buy-and-build opportunities, offshoring manufacturing and sourcing international suppliers

• We focus on three core sectors: consumer, business & technology services and industrial. In each we have a proven track record and a deep international network of contacts

We provide investment solutions for growing companies. Access to both 3i’s balance sheet and external capital allows us significant flexibility in how we finance deals and the length of our investment hold period.

Sector growth will continue to be driven by increasing sophistication of business to business value chains and external factors such as regulatory and legislative requirements.

We invest in businesses with a service offering that is value adding, backed by intellectual property and sufficiently focused to be differentiated from larger players. The high quality of businesses with these characteristics is typically evidenced through strong client relationships, attractive margins and a high level of revenue visibility.

Areas we are particularly focused on include testing, inspection & certification, intelligent or value added outsourcing, technology led outsourcing (including tech-enabled services and software) and education.

The business & technology services market is large and diverse, across a number of verticals and service types

A number of these trends are consumer driven, others are technology driven.

Consumer driven trends include, polarisation (i.e. customers seeking luxury and value for money at the expense of the middle market), growing demand for convenience, leisure and wellness, and changing demographics.

Technology driven trends include ecommerce, digital marketing, big data, internet of things.

We invest in businesses that take advantage of these trends, targeting distinctive companies with strong international growth potential.

There are several trends in the Consumer Sector that are reshaping the entire industry

Executed strong buy & build strategy, acquiring German headquartered SDI (entrance into the German carbonated soft drinks market), Taja in Poland and Spumador in Italy (leading Italian private label manufacturer)

This took Refresco’s production facilities to 27 across nine countries with a total of 159 production lines and a truly pan-European footprint

Merger with Gerber Emig in 2013 was a transformational value driver, enhancing the company’s presence across Europe and strengthening its capability for industry innovation

Refresco completed its IPO on Euronext Amsterdam in March 2015

Key events under our ownership

From European juice manufacturer to leading European independent bottler of soft drinks for A-brand owners

Industrial

We have a long track record of helping industrial and engineering businesses grow into global leaders

We look for businesses with international potential that are leaders in their niche and are typically a critical product for their customers.

As industrial supply-chains become more global and requirements for quality, innovation and fulfilment increase, we see greater opportunities to support international expansion both from a sales and supply chain perspective.

In addition, with the advent of “Industry 4.0”, we are looking for ways to invest around the key trends of increased automation, data availability and connectivity which are driving a convergence of industrial products and services.
